    Overview of the 2020 Infiniti Q50 Red Sport

    The Infiniti Q50 Red Sport 2020 is the performance-oriented version of the Q50 sedan, slotting at the top of the Q50 range. It's designed to offer a more engaging driving experience compared to the standard models, thanks to its powerful engine and upgraded components. This car aims to compete with other luxury sport sedans from brands like BMW, Mercedes-Benz, and Audi, providing a unique blend of Japanese craftsmanship and performance engineering. From its aggressive styling to its advanced technology, the Q50 Red Sport is built to impress.

    Exterior Design and Styling

    When it comes to curb appeal, the 2020 Infiniti Q50 Red Sport doesn't disappoint. The exterior design is both elegant and aggressive, featuring a distinctive double-arch grille with a mesh insert that sets it apart from the lower trims. The sleek LED headlights and daytime running lights add a modern touch, while the sculpted hood hints at the power beneath. Unique to the Red Sport are the sporty front and rear fascias, which enhance its athletic stance. The car also features exclusive 19-inch alloy wheels that complement its overall design. Chrome accents around the windows and door handles add a touch of luxury, while the Red Sport badging subtly announces its performance capabilities. The overall design strikes a balance between sophistication and sportiness, making it a head-turner on the road. You will find that the attention to detail in the exterior is very impressive.

    Interior Comfort and Features

    Stepping inside the 2020 Infiniti Q50 Red Sport, you're greeted with a luxurious and well-appointed cabin. The interior is designed with premium materials, including leather upholstery and aluminum trim, creating a sophisticated ambiance. The sport seats are comfortable and supportive, providing excellent bolstering during spirited driving. The cabin is equipped with a dual-screen infotainment system, featuring an 8-inch upper screen and a 7-inch lower screen. This system controls navigation, audio, and vehicle settings. Apple CarPlay and Android Auto compatibility are standard, allowing seamless smartphone integration. Other notable features include a Bose Performance Series audio system, which delivers crystal-clear sound, and a power moonroof, which adds an open and airy feel to the cabin. The interior is also equipped with advanced safety features such as blind-spot monitoring, lane departure warning, and adaptive cruise control, ensuring a safe and comfortable driving experience. Overall, the interior of the Q50 Red Sport is a blend of luxury, technology, and comfort.

    Engine and Performance Specs

    Under the hood, the 2020 Infiniti Q50 Red Sport is powered by a 3.0-liter twin-turbo V6 engine that delivers an impressive 400 horsepower and 350 lb-ft of torque. This engine is a masterpiece of engineering, providing smooth and responsive power across the rev range. The car is available with either rear-wheel drive or all-wheel drive, depending on your preference and driving conditions. The engine is paired with a 7-speed automatic transmission that offers quick and precise shifts. In terms of performance, the Q50 Red Sport can accelerate from 0 to 60 mph in around 4.5 seconds, making it one of the quickest sedans in its class. The car also features a sport-tuned suspension and upgraded brakes, which enhance its handling and stopping power. The Red Sport also includes Infiniti's Drive Mode Selector, allowing you to customize the driving experience with settings like Standard, Sport, Eco, and Snow. Whether you're cruising on the highway or tackling twisty roads, the Q50 Red Sport delivers thrilling performance.

    Driving Experience and Handling

    The driving experience of the 2020 Infiniti Q50 Red Sport is where it truly shines. The powerful V6 engine provides exhilarating acceleration, making it easy to pass other cars on the highway or blast through your favorite back roads. The sport-tuned suspension keeps the car planted and composed, even when cornering aggressively. The steering is precise and well-weighted, providing good feedback from the road. The upgraded brakes offer confident stopping power, ensuring you can always maintain control. One of the standout features is the adaptive suspension, which adjusts the damping force based on road conditions and driving style, providing a comfortable ride without sacrificing performance. The Q50 Red Sport also benefits from Infiniti's Direct Adaptive Steering system, which offers customizable steering feel and response. While some drivers may find the steering a bit artificial, it does provide a unique and engaging driving experience. Overall, the Q50 Red Sport is a joy to drive, offering a perfect blend of performance, comfort, and technology.

    Technology and Infotainment System

    The 2020 Infiniti Q50 Red Sport comes equipped with a state-of-the-art technology and infotainment system. The centerpiece of the system is the dual-screen display, which includes an 8-inch upper screen and a 7-inch lower screen. The upper screen is primarily used for navigation and information display, while the lower screen controls audio, climate, and vehicle settings. The system supports Apple CarPlay and Android Auto, allowing you to seamlessly integrate your smartphone. The car also features a Bose Performance Series audio system, which delivers exceptional sound quality. Other notable tech features include a Wi-Fi hotspot, Bluetooth connectivity, and multiple USB ports. The Q50 Red Sport also includes advanced driver-assistance features such as blind-spot monitoring, lane departure warning, adaptive cruise control, and automatic emergency braking. These features enhance safety and convenience, making the Q50 Red Sport a technologically advanced and user-friendly vehicle. While the dual-screen system may take some getting used to, it offers a wide range of functionalities and customization options.

    Safety Features and Ratings

    When it comes to safety, the 2020 Infiniti Q50 Red Sport is well-equipped with a comprehensive suite of safety features. Standard safety equipment includes anti-lock brakes, stability control, traction control, and a full complement of airbags. The car also features advanced driver-assistance systems such as blind-spot monitoring, lane departure warning, rear cross-traffic alert, and forward collision warning with automatic emergency braking. These systems help to prevent accidents and protect occupants in the event of a collision. The Q50 Red Sport has been tested by the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A) and the Insurance Institute for Highway Safety (IIHS), earning good ratings in most categories. While specific ratings may vary, the Q50 Red Sport generally performs well in crash tests, providing peace of mind for drivers and passengers. Overall, the Q50 Red Sport is designed with safety in mind, offering a range of features to help you stay safe on the road.

    Pricing and Value

    The 2020 Infiniti Q50 Red Sport is positioned as a premium sport sedan, and its pricing reflects that. The base price for the Q50 Red Sport typically starts in the mid-40s, depending on the configuration and options. While this is more expensive than the base Q50 models, it's competitive with other luxury sport sedans in its class. When considering the value proposition, the Q50 Red Sport offers a lot for the money. It combines powerful performance, luxurious features, and advanced technology in a stylish package. Compared to rivals from BMW, Mercedes-Benz, and Audi, the Q50 Red Sport often offers a better value, with more standard features and a lower overall cost of ownership. Additionally, Infiniti offers a competitive warranty and maintenance program, adding to the overall value. If you're looking for a luxury sport sedan that delivers performance and features without breaking the bank, the Q50 Red Sport is definitely worth considering.

    Pros and Cons of the 2020 Infiniti Q50 Red Sport

    To give you a balanced perspective, let's break down the pros and cons of the 2020 Infiniti Q50 Red Sport:

    Pros:

    • Powerful 3.0-liter twin-turbo V6 engine
    • Sporty and aggressive styling
    • Luxurious and well-appointed interior
    • Advanced technology and infotainment system
    • Available all-wheel drive
    • Competitive pricing

    Cons:

    • Direct Adaptive Steering may not appeal to all drivers
    • Dual-screen infotainment system can be complex
    • Fuel economy could be better
